SLIDE TO SUPPORT LOCAL CHARITIES WITH THE LIBERTY THIS SUMMER
Weininger Resistance Sliding (WRS) is a popular, unique, impact-free sport that everyone can enjoy, regardless of physical ability. Sliding on a specially designed mat, the aim is to get to the end of the course before your competitors and record your time, hoping that you’ll beat the rest!
WRS will be in The Liberty Shopping Centre between Monday 25th and Friday 29th July and Monday 29th August and Friday 2nd September.
The Liberty will be tracking the times of all participants, and the person with the overall fastest time across all the days of the event will receive a £500 donation to the charity of their choice. Additionally, the winner of the fastest time each day will be rewarded with a £20 gift card from The Liberty.
WRS Sliding is engaging, fun, completely inclusive and open to all - young and old, able-bodied and disabled - so anyone could be in with a chance of winning the top prize for a cause close to their heart.
